The Coventry Building Society is an active member of the Building Societies Association and is authorised and regulated by the Financial Services Authority.

The Coventry Building Society was first founded in 1884 by a number of local citizens and was first known as The Coventry Permanent Economic Building Society. One of its founders – Mr Thomas Mason Daffern went on to become the society’s first secretary.

A number of mergers in the 1970s and 1980s saw the Coventry grow from strength to strength. It was in 1983 that it first became known as the Coventry Building Society following a merger with the Coventry Provident.

The Coventry Building Society is keen to remind people that it is not owned by any external shareholders but by its members – the society’s borrowers and savers. There are no dividend payouts so all profits can be ploughed back in order to keep all their products ultra competitive.
